E-learning Market to grow by USD 147.79 billion through 2025|Impacts of Drivers and Challenges|Technavio
NEW YORK, May 26, 2021 /PRNewswire/ -- Technavio has been monitoring the e-learning market and it is poised to grow by USD 147.79 billion during 2021-2025, progressing at a CAGR of over 16% during the forecast period. The market is fragmented, and the degree of fragmentation will accelerate during the forecast period. Adobe Inc., Articulate Global Inc., Cengage Learning Holdings II Inc., Cisco Systems Inc., City and Guilds Group, Instructure Inc., John Wiley and Sons Inc., Pearson Plc, Skillsoft Ltd., and Thomson Reuters Corp. are some of the major market participants. Although the rising adoption of gamification will offer immense growth opportunities, the increase in the development of in-house content is likely to pose a challenge for the market vendors. Higher education was the largest segment of the market in 2020 and will continue to be the largest segment of the market in 2025, growing faster than the overall market. It would grow at a compounded annual growth rate of over 18% between 2020 and 2025.

North America was the largest region of the market in 2020 and would continue to be the largest segment of the market in 2025. It would grow at a compounded annual growth rate of around 17% between 2020 and 2025, which is faster than the overall market.
